Beverly Whitson-Gaston

August 20, 1937 — October 20, 2016

Beverly Whitson-Gaston went to be with the lord Thursday morning after a short bout of cancer at the age of 79. Mrs Whitson was born in Lincoln Nebraska and was raised in Olathe Kansas on August 20th, 1937, she was the youngest of 5 children. She lived in various places until she met and married Norman E. Whitson who was born and raised in Elk City Kansas on December 21, 1953, she was 16 years old. The couple moved back to Independence when he was discharged from the army after having served in the Korean war, and lived here since. He proceeded her in death February 1996, they were married 43 years. She later married Curtis A. Gaston from Joplin Mo, He also preceded her in death July 2013. They were married for 12 years. Mrs Whitson had 6 children, Mary Jabben, Steve and Nora Whitson, Mike Whitson, and Vickie and Bill Kinnamon, Rick and Erica Whitson all of Independence, David and Sue Whitson of Bloomfield New Mexico. 20 grandchildren and 35 great grandchildren and 1 great, great grandchild.
Beverly returned to school after her children were grown and finished her high school education and gained an associates degree with honors from ICC. She worked several places but retired from the Montgomery county treasurer's office in 2001. She was a member of the Independence Nazarene church.

Beverly was a wonderful person and was truly loved by all. Her entire life was a shining example of how Jesus intended Christian people to live. And that example will live on in her family for generations. She was kind, loving and extremely generous. She will be sorely missed.
